Output 9f572cb33bd485029ecd5db60c28fa1d31f08dc47a912117cb2422190849a14b:0

value
11079563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b511818583f2198a5b25e3b71b975206a7ae5a0e OP_EQUAL
address
3JCRCbiS8aUWYJwJ2PJkrKFhzNFjGLhFfA
transaction
9f572cb33bd485029ecd5db60c28fa1d31f08dc47a912117cb2422190849a14b
spent
true